Originally Posted by koach
So does anyone know of any good Evo tuners in the greater Dayton area? I'm thinking about going the Cobb AP route, but if I get more advanced mods I will probably want a custom tuner.
There isn't any "tuners" in the SW Ohio area. Your only option is to either go to Buschur or AMS. Both are a good 3+ hour drive minimum.

You really don't need a COBB access port. We have the capability to tune and flash the stock ECU and easily do everything the access port can. Many of us (myself included) tune our own cars.

Search in the EcuFlash forums for more information.

I realize what you are saying....but if you look at those plots the dyno was not set up properly. The crossover point for Tq and Hp must be 5250 rpm. Theirs is like 5800 something which tells me that it is not calibrated properly. I could go on more, but I will leave it at that.

For the most part tuning is tuning. Anyone can do it. But, those that can do more than just create big peak hp numbers will be the ideal tuner to go to.

I'd be curious to see that car on the strip...it's time and trap speed would tell the truth.
